SEBI Introduces New Guidelines for B30 Incentives to Enhance Investor Engagement

Similarly, distributors will also get an additional incentive of a similar amount on new SIPs started by first-time investors (identified by PAN).

The additional distribution commission will be paid from the 2 basis points on daily net assets, mandated to be set apart annually by AMCs for investor education, awareness and financial inclusion initiatives, subject to adequate claw-back provisions, it said on Thursday.

The new commission will be in addition to the existing trail commission paid to the distributor from the scheme.

Distributors will be eligible to receive the additional commission for mobilising investments from new women investors from the top 30 cities. However, dual incentives for the same investor/investment will not be permitted, it said.

Additional incentive will not be available in Exchange Traded Funds, Fund of Funds (domestic), Overnight, Liquid, Ultra Short Duration and Low Duration funds.

To ensure uniform implementation, AMFI, in consultation with SEBI, will issue the necessary implementation standards within 30 calendar days, it added.
